Antibiotics For Groin Pain. Getting Boils, Unable To Lift Legs, Blood Test Normal. Specialist Help Required?
I have a grandson that is 8 years old and has been getting boils for some reason. He has had pain in the groan and has been on antibiotics on and off. He is now complaining of left side back pain and when taken to the dr. he was asked to lift his legs and he couldn t -- when the dr. lifted them, they fell back down. I am really getting worried about just seeing a regular doctor, he has has blood test taken (all good). Should we take him to an internal medicine or specialist that can do further testing in case he still has infection from having these boils? Concerned!
Hi
Some children get boils frequently most commonly during summer and in the areas where there is excessive sweating. If blood tests are normal nothing to worry and in most of the cases of boils the tests will be normal. Whenever he gets boils during that time antibiotic treatment is necessary. At present this left side back pain looking like a different problem so consult Pediatrician for medical advise.
